Offene Handelsgesellschaft

The term Offene Handelsgesellschaft, abbreviated OHG, is one of the three forms of limited partnership known in Germany and is a general form of partnership specialising in trade. All partners are fully liable for the partnership's debts. It is not a legal entity but can acquire rights and liabilities, acquire title to property and sue or be sued.
